    2.4 Buttons, Indicators and adjustment knobs Power Indicator When the printer is in the power-on state, the Power indicator is lit. On-Line Indicator This green On-Line indicator is lit when the printer is ready. The On-Line indicator blinks when in PAUSE mode.     3.6 Self-test To initiate the self-test mode, press t he MENU button to advance the selection to Printer Test. Press the EXE button to enter the submenu and press the MENU button to advance the selection to Printe r Config. Press EXE button to print the printer’s internal settings.     To initialize the printer: 1. Turn off the printer power 2. Hold down the PAUSE and FEED buttons and turn on the printer power 3. Release the buttons once the Powe r, On-Line, and Error lights are lit Note: The printing method, thermal tran sfer or direct thermal printing, will be set automatically at the activati on of printer power by checking fo ...
